The surprise in this data was the significant drop in Apple PC shipments. According to the report, Apple’s performance fell between 23% and 29%. The only company to show a similar double-digit decline was Asus, which dropped between 10.7% and 11.5%.
In contrast, HP was the only company to achieve positive results, posting growth between 6.4% and 6.5% according to IDC, Gartner and Canalys. Analysts believe the upcoming holiday shopping season could further boost growth in the PC market and possibly signal the end of a long decline.
Mikako Kitagawa, managing analyst at Gartner, said there is reason to believe that the PC market decline has bottomed out, giving hope for a brighter future for the industry.
